Safety

Is Grange Road dangerous?

In 2023, 423 crimes were reported near Grange Road . Only 24% of streets in the UK are more dangerous. This street can be considered not safe. The most common type of crime was violence and sexual offences. Crime rate was measured within a 0.5 mile radius of PE3 9DT.
